Toggle navigation
Home
Contact
Add Your Business
Download Business Data
Commercial Photo Studios in Mountain View, CA
5 businesses found
All Designs Content And Images Are Subject To
2250 Latham St , 94040
Phone:
(650) 967-0101
Sollecito Photography
2256 Mora Drive , 94040
Phone:
(650) 428-0131
Hollywood Images
1516 Meadow Lane , 94040
Phone:
(650) 961-8848
Kimball Stock
1960 Colony St , 94043
Phone:
(650) 969-0682
John Ho Photography
2259 Old Middlefield Way , 94043
Phone:
(408) 978-7254